Introduction

The Allen Bradley 1747-L552 CPU Processor Unit Module delivers high-speed, reliable control for SLC 5/05 automation systems. Its robust design, seamless integration with I/O modules, and advanced diagnostics ensure efficient, continuous operation in complex industrial environments.

Applications

The Allen Bradley 1747-L552 CPU Processor Unit Module is engineered for high-performance control in industrial automation systems. Its applications include:

  • Acting as the central processor for SLC 5/05 systems in manufacturing and process industries
  • Managing advanced sequential logic, motion control, and process operations
  • Coordinating digital and analog I/O modules for real-time control and monitoring
  • Integrating with SCADA and supervisory systems for centralized automation
  • Supporting predictive maintenance and diagnostics to minimize downtime
